La Veta Blanca is a wall and reef site located along the Costa Brava coastline near Colera. Divers typically explore depths between 18 and 25 metres, with an average depth of 22 metres. The site features mild currents and visibility ranging from 10 to 30 metres, making it suitable for beginner divers. Access is available from both shore and boat, though entry points contain sharp rocks and coral that require caution. Facilities at the site include parking, toilets, showers, changing rooms, and air fills. A typical dive lasts 45 minutes, and water temperatures fluctuate between 13 and 20 degrees Celsius throughout the year.

The site is accessible from shore or by boat, and the entry area can involve sharp rocks, so reef shoes or boots are worth wearing. Full facilities including air fills, showers, and changing rooms are available on site, so you can pack light and fill tanks locally.
